A day in the life:

As a First Charge Mortgage Case Manager, you'll play a pivotal role in providing top-notch service to our valued customers. Collaborating with industry experts, you'll build meaningful relationships and contribute to our shared mission of financial empowerment.

You’ll be an enthusiastic and driven individual, with high attention to detail and great people skills.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Effectively managing a pipeline of first charge mortgage applications through to completion
  • Fully reviewing new cases where customers have responded, accurately underwriting cases in accordance with lender criteria
  • Processing and undertaking all necessary administrative work
  • Corresponding both in writing and verbally with your customers throughout the process
  • Requesting all required information from third parties e.g., mortgage companies, management companies, solicitors, accountants & surveyors

About Fluent Money:

At Fluent Money, we're more than just a financial services company—we're industry leaders committed to integrity, professionalism, and unparalleled customer satisfaction. Not only are we the biggest Second Charge Mortgage Broker in the UK, we also specialise in First Charge Mortgages, Equity Release, Insurance and Bridging Loans. As part of the Mortgage Advice Bureau (MAB) family since 2022, we're dedicated to excellence in everything we do.
